This is also wrong. AFAICS the variables are never set to "NO", only "yes" (in lowercase) when the relevant configure
test succeeds. Otherwise they remain unset.

Also, what is this patch trying to do? emms.asm is used/needed only if HAVE_MM_EMPTY and HAVE_MMX_INLINE
are not set, and of course can only be assembled if HAVE_EXTERNAL_MMX is set.
Something like $(EMMS_OBJS__yes_) would assemble it only when really needed, but nonetheless this all seems like
unnecessary complexity to prevent a ~200 bytes object to be assembled and included in the library.
